Welcome to ApneaBoard tuumi2000.  I see a few problems in your charts. 
 
1.  You have some clustering of OA's.  This could be caused by chin tucking (positional).  You can try lowering your pillow height, switching sleeping position (ex:  from on back to on side), and getting a soft cervical collar if the first two things don't work in reducing the clusters.  

2.   You have some high flow limitations in one of the graphs.  You have EPR at 3 full time though.  That is good.  

3.  You might try raising your pressure a little bit.  You can go in increments of 0.2 or even go straight from 11 to 12 if you want.  You know yourself best.  You have some variability of results between the 3 charts.  We will try to get your therapy optimized so that the most of nightly charts look good (a trend starts).  

It is rare for someone to immediately feel better after starting pap therapy.  It takes time usually to start seeing some results.  And there are a few who never seem to see results.  I am basing this on reading many threads and posts here.
